Transaction 4ec23a6d567f406df3f80262821caf8d612a3ee1f1837e38096b4ac1e34d9011

1 Input
2 Outputs
  • 4ec23a6d567f406df3f80262821caf8d612a3ee1f1837e38096b4ac1e34d9011:0
  • value  1740841
    address  3A5GaBhY9DGjgiwdqqSwnMY4phsFDEXznN
  • 4ec23a6d567f406df3f80262821caf8d612a3ee1f1837e38096b4ac1e34d9011:1
  • value  74350902
    address  3HjhrgitVbKQYw8duMM3a1viaujyB2V9wH